Step-by-Step Exterior Washing Procedure in Freezing Temperatures

A methodical approach is essential to prevent water from freezing on your car’s surfaces or in its components. This process focuses on speed and efficiency while ensuring all contaminants are removed.

  1. Pre-Rinse and Salt Removal: Begin by thoroughly rinsing the vehicle with lukewarm water. This initial rinse helps to loosen and remove the bulk of road salt, grime, and loose dirt. Pay close attention to the lower panels, wheel wells, and rocker panels, as these areas accumulate the most salt and slush.
  2. Two-Bucket Wash Method: Employ the two-bucket method. One bucket contains your car wash solution (diluted according to manufacturer instructions), and the other contains clean rinse water. Dip your wash mitt into the soap solution, wash a section of the car, and then rinse the mitt thoroughly in the clean water before dipping it back into the soap solution. This prevents transferring dirt and grit back onto the paint, minimizing the risk of scratching.

  3. Work in Sections: Wash the car from top to bottom, working on one section at a time (e.g., the roof, then the hood, then a side panel). This allows you to rinse each section immediately after washing, reducing the chance of soap drying and freezing.
  4. Rinse Thoroughly: After washing each section, rinse it immediately with lukewarm water. Ensure all soap residue is removed, as dried soap can leave streaks and attract dirt.
  5. Drying: This is a critical step in cold weather. Use high-quality microfiber drying towels to absorb as much water as possible. Work quickly and efficiently. Pay special attention to door jambs, mirrors, window seals, and other areas where water can collect and freeze.
  6. Door and Trunk Seal Treatment: Once the car is dry, apply a rubber protectant or silicone spray to door seals, trunk seals, and window seals. This prevents them from freezing shut and protects the rubber from cracking.
  7. Final Touches: Apply a spray wax or quick detailer to enhance gloss and provide an extra layer of protection against the elements.

Preventing Water Freezing During the Washing Process

The primary concern during winter washing is the rapid freezing of water. Implementing specific strategies can significantly mitigate this risk.

  1. Use Lukewarm Water: Always use lukewarm water for rinsing and for your wash solution. This helps to melt ice and snow on contact and slows down the freezing process compared to cold water. Avoid using hot water, as the drastic temperature change can potentially shock and damage paint.
  2. Work Indoors or in a Sheltered Area: If possible, wash your car in a garage or a sheltered car wash bay. This provides a buffer against wind and ambient cold, allowing more time before water freezes.
  3. Quick and Efficient Washing: Minimize the time the car is wet. Work methodically and have all your supplies ready before you begin. The faster you can wash and dry, the less opportunity water has to freeze.
  4. Avoid Washing in Direct Sunlight: While sunlight might seem helpful, it can cause water to evaporate and freeze unevenly, potentially leading to water spots or ice formation in crevices.
  5. Use Detailing Sprays for Light Cleaning: For lighter grime, consider using a waterless wash or rinseless wash product. These methods use specialized cleaning solutions that encapsulate dirt, allowing it to be wiped away safely with microfiber towels, using minimal water.

Techniques for Removing Road Salt and Grime

Road salt and the associated grime are particularly corrosive and damaging to your vehicle’s paint and undercarriage. Effective removal is paramount.

  1. Pre-Soak and Rinse: Before applying soap, a thorough pre-rinse with lukewarm water is essential to dislodge as much salt and loose debris as possible. Focus on the lower parts of the vehicle.
  2. Salt-Specific Cleaners: Consider using a dedicated salt-removing car wash soap. These formulations are designed to neutralize and break down salt deposits more effectively than standard car soaps.
  3. Wheel and Tire Cleaner: Wheels and tires are often heavily coated in salt and grime. Use a pH-neutral wheel cleaner and a stiff brush to agitate and remove stubborn deposits. Rinse thoroughly afterward.
  4. Undercarriage Wash: Salt and grime accumulate heavily on the undercarriage. If you have access to a pressure washer or a car wash with an undercarriage spray, use it to blast away these corrosive contaminants.
  5. Detailing Brushes: Use detailing brushes to get into tight areas like grilles, emblems, and panel gaps where salt and dirt can hide.

Paint Sealant and Wax Application for Winter

Applying a high-quality paint sealant or wax before winter sets in is one of the most effective ways to protect your vehicle’s finish. These products create a sacrificial layer that can be easily replenished or reapplied if damaged, protecting the original paintwork underneath. The key is to choose a product that offers excellent durability and hydrophobic properties, meaning it will actively repel water and prevent ice from bonding strongly to the surface.A good sealant or wax will not only provide protection but also enhance the gloss and depth of your car’s paint.

For winter, opt for synthetic sealants, as they generally offer longer-lasting protection and better resistance to harsh chemicals compared to traditional carnauba waxes. Application is straightforward and can be done in a temperature-controlled environment, ideally before the severe cold arrives.The application process typically involves thoroughly washing and drying the vehicle, followed by clay barring to remove any embedded contaminants. Once the surface is clean and smooth, the sealant or wax can be applied according to the product’s instructions, usually in thin, even coats.

Buffing off the residue reveals a slick, protected surface.

Addressing Minor Scratches and Swirl Marks Before Protection

Before applying any protective sealant, wax, or ceramic coating, it is crucial to address any existing imperfections on the paintwork. Minor scratches and swirl marks can trap dirt and moisture, and if left untreated, they can worsen over time, especially under the harsh conditions of winter. Addressing these issues ensures that the protective layer is applied to a flawless surface, maximizing its effectiveness and aesthetic appeal.Minor scratches and swirl marks are typically caused by improper washing techniques, such as using abrasive cloths or washing in direct sunlight.

These imperfections disrupt the smooth surface of the paint, creating areas where contaminants can easily adhere and build up.To deal with these imperfections, a multi-step process is recommended:

  • Inspection: Carefully inspect the paintwork under good lighting to identify the extent and depth of scratches and swirl marks.
  • Decontamination: Thoroughly wash and decontaminate the vehicle, ideally using a clay bar to remove any bonded surface contaminants that could interfere with the correction process.
  • Paint Correction: For light swirl marks and minor scratches, machine polishing with a fine-grit compound and a polishing pad is often effective. This process removes a microscopic layer of the clear coat to level the surface. For deeper scratches that cannot be felt with a fingernail, touch-up paint might be necessary, though these are more challenging to correct perfectly.
  • Wipe Down: After polishing, use an IPA (Isopropyl Alcohol) solution or a dedicated panel wipe to remove any polishing oils, ensuring a truly clean surface for the protective layer.

It is important to note that while DIY paint correction is possible for minor imperfections, severe scratches or damage may require professional attention to avoid further damage to the paint.

Optimal Application Methods for Winter Paint Protection

Applying winter-specific paint protection requires attention to detail and the right conditions to ensure maximum adhesion and durability. Whether you choose a synthetic sealant, a durable wax, or a ceramic coating, proper application is key to achieving the best results against the rigors of winter. The goal is to create a uniform, robust layer that offers maximum resistance to the elements.For products applied via a wipe-on, wipe-off method, such as many sealants and waxes, ensuring an even application is critical.

Over-application can lead to streaking and a less durable finish.

  • Temperature Control: Apply products in a cool, dry environment, ideally between 50-80°F (10-27°C). Avoid applying in direct sunlight or on hot surfaces, as this can cause the product to dry too quickly, making it difficult to remove and potentially leading to streaks. For winter, this means working in a garage or during the warmest part of the day if working outdoors.

  • Thin, Even Coats: Apply the product using a foam applicator pad in thin, overlapping passes. For sealants and waxes, a little goes a long way. For ceramic coatings, follow the manufacturer’s specific instructions, which often involve applying in small sections and immediately leveling or buffing off.
  • Working in Sections: For larger vehicles, it is often beneficial to work on one panel or section at a time. This prevents the product from drying out before you can level or buff it off.
  • Leveling and Buffing: After the product has flashed or hazed according to the manufacturer’s instructions, use a clean, high-quality microfiber towel to gently buff off the residue. For ceramic coatings, specific leveling and buffing towels and techniques are often recommended to ensure a streak-free finish.
  • Curing Time: Allow adequate curing time for the product to fully bond with the paint. Many sealants and waxes require a few hours, while ceramic coatings can take 24-48 hours or even longer to fully cure, during which time the vehicle should be protected from moisture.

“Proper application is not just about aesthetics; it’s about creating a resilient barrier that stands up to winter’s worst.”

When using spray sealants or waxes, ensure even coverage by spraying lightly onto the applicator pad or directly onto the panel, then spreading it out. For ceramic coatings, meticulous application is paramount, as mistakes are harder to correct once cured. Always refer to the specific product’s instructions, as formulations and application requirements can vary significantly.

Cleaning Winter Road Salt and Brake Dust from Alloy Wheels

Alloy wheels are susceptible to damage from road salt and the accumulation of brake dust, especially in winter conditions. A thorough cleaning process is essential to prevent long-term corrosion and maintain their appearance.The best method involves a multi-step approach using specialized cleaning products and gentle techniques. Begin by rinsing the wheels thoroughly with water to remove loose debris and salt.

Then, apply a pH-neutral wheel cleaner designed for your specific wheel finish. For stubborn brake dust and salt residue, a dedicated wheel cleaner with a slightly acidic or alkaline formulation (always check manufacturer recommendations) might be necessary, but ensure it’s safe for your alloy type.

  • Rinsing: Always start with a good rinse to dislodge loose salt and dirt.
  • Wheel Cleaner Application: Spray wheel cleaner generously onto one wheel at a time. Allow it to dwell for the recommended time to break down contaminants.
  • Agitation: Use a soft-bristled wheel brush or a detailing mitt to gently agitate the cleaner. For intricate wheel designs, use various brushes to reach all areas.
  • Stubborn Contaminants: For baked-on brake dust or heavy salt buildup, consider using an iron remover product. These products chemically dissolve iron particles, making them easier to rinse away. Follow the product’s instructions carefully.
  • Final Rinse: Rinse each wheel thoroughly with clean water, ensuring all cleaning product and loosened contaminants are washed away.
  • Drying: Dry the wheels immediately with a clean, soft microfiber towel to prevent water spots, especially in cold weather where water can freeze.

Maintaining Tire Pressure and Tread Health During Colder Months

Cold weather significantly impacts tire pressure and can accelerate wear on treads if not managed properly. Maintaining optimal tire pressure and healthy tread depth is vital for safety, fuel efficiency, and tire longevity.Tire pressure decreases as temperatures drop because the air inside the tire contracts. This can lead to underinflation, which affects handling, increases wear, and reduces fuel economy. Similarly, worn tread depths compromise grip, especially on slippery winter roads.

  • Tire Pressure Checks: Check tire pressure at least once a month, and more frequently when there are significant temperature fluctuations. The ideal time to check is when the tires are cold, meaning the vehicle has not been driven for at least three hours or has been driven less than a mile at moderate speed.
  • Recommended Pressure: Always inflate tires to the pressure recommended by the vehicle manufacturer, found on a sticker in the driver’s side doorjamb, glove compartment, or fuel filler door. Do not use the maximum pressure listed on the tire sidewall.
  • Tread Depth Inspection: Regularly inspect your tire tread for wear. A common method is using a tread depth gauge or the “penny test.” Insert a penny into the deepest part of the tread with Lincoln’s head facing down. If the top of Lincoln’s head is visible, your tread depth is likely below the safe minimum of 2/32 of an inch (approximately 1.6 mm) and the tires should be replaced.

  • Tire Rotation: If you haven’t already, consider rotating your tires regularly (typically every 5,000-7,500 miles) to ensure even wear, which helps maintain consistent tread depth across all tires.
  • Winter Tires: For regions with significant snow and ice, consider investing in dedicated winter tires. These tires are designed with special rubber compounds and tread patterns that provide superior grip in cold temperatures and slippery conditions.

Applying Tire Dressings That Can Withstand Cold and Wet Conditions

Tire dressings enhance the appearance of tires, giving them a clean, rich black look. However, not all dressings are created equal, and some perform poorly in cold and wet winter conditions, attracting dirt or not lasting long.The best tire dressings for winter are those that offer durability, resist water spotting, and do not attract excessive road grime. Water-based dressings with polymer or silicone technology tend to perform better in colder climates.

  • Choosing the Right Dressing: Opt for water-based tire dressings that contain polymers or advanced silicone formulas. These tend to bond better to the tire surface and offer greater resistance to water and salt. Avoid oil-based dressings, which can attract more dirt and may not perform as well in freezing temperatures.
  • Surface Preparation: Before applying any dressing, thoroughly clean the tire sidewalls. Use a dedicated tire cleaner and a stiff brush to remove all dirt, brake dust, and old dressing residue. A clean surface is crucial for the dressing to adhere properly and last longer.
  • Application Technique:
    • Apply the dressing to a foam applicator pad or a microfiber applicator.
    • Work in sections, applying a thin, even coat to the tire sidewall. Avoid getting the dressing on the tread surface, as this can reduce traction.
    • Allow the dressing to dry for the manufacturer’s recommended time. Some products may require a second light coat for a deeper shine.
    • For a more matte finish, buff off any excess product with a clean microfiber towel after the initial drying period.
  • Durability in Cold: Look for products that specifically mention “long-lasting” or “all-weather” performance. These are formulated to withstand the stresses of winter driving, including frequent exposure to moisture and salt.
  • Avoiding Over-Application: Applying too much dressing can lead to sling-off onto the vehicle’s paintwork, especially at higher speeds, and can also attract more dirt. A thin, even coat is generally more effective and durable.

Moisture Management and Mold Prevention

One of the most significant challenges in winter car interiors is moisture buildup. Snow and ice tracked in on footwear, combined with condensation from breath, can create a damp environment. This humidity is a breeding ground for mold and mildew, which can cause unpleasant odors and health issues. Implementing effective moisture management strategies is therefore paramount.

Several techniques can be employed to mitigate moisture and prevent mold and mildew:

  • Ventilation: Whenever possible, open windows for a few minutes to allow moist air to escape, even on colder days. This is especially beneficial after a period of heavy use.
  • Dehumidifiers: Utilize automotive dehumidifier bags or silica gel packets placed strategically under seats or in the trunk. These absorb excess moisture from the air. Rechargeable options are available for repeated use.
  • Floor Mat Care: Remove rubber or all-weather floor mats regularly to shake off accumulated snow and moisture. Allow them to dry completely before reinserting them.
  • Air Circulation: Running the car’s fan on a fresh air setting (not recirculate) can help to circulate air and reduce humidity levels within the cabin.
  • Immediate Spill Cleanup: Address any spills promptly. Dampness from drinks or melted snow needs to be absorbed quickly to prevent it from soaking into carpets and upholstery.

Interior Window and Mirror De-icing and Cleaning

Fogging and ice formation on the inside of car windows and mirrors are common winter problems, impairing visibility. Effective cleaning and de-icing techniques are crucial for safe driving.

To de-ice interior windows, avoid using hot water, as the sudden temperature change can crack the glass. Instead, use a dedicated interior glass cleaner and a clean microfiber cloth. For stubborn ice, you can gently use a plastic ice scraper designed for automotive use, taking care not to scratch the glass. Once the ice is removed, spray the glass cleaner onto a clean microfiber towel and wipe the windows and mirrors thoroughly.

For general cleaning and fog prevention, ensure you are using a high-quality automotive glass cleaner. Ammonia-based cleaners can be harsh on window tint and some interior surfaces, so opt for ammonia-free formulas. Spray the cleaner onto the microfiber towel, not directly onto the glass, to prevent overspray onto other interior surfaces. Wipe the glass in a consistent pattern, such as horizontal strokes on the inside and vertical strokes on the outside, to easily identify any missed spots or streaks.

Pay close attention to the corners and edges of the windows and mirrors.

Maintaining clear interior visibility is not just about aesthetics; it is a critical safety measure during winter driving conditions.

Regularly cleaning the interior glass, even when there is no visible fog or ice, helps to remove the film of grime that can contribute to fogging. A clean surface is less likely to attract condensation. Consider using an anti-fog treatment specifically designed for automotive glass, applying it according to the product’s instructions after cleaning for enhanced protection against fogging throughout the winter.

Preventing Interior Fogging

Interior fogging on car windows during winter drives is a common and frustrating issue, caused by the difference in temperature and humidity between the car’s interior and the exterior. Condensation forms on the cooler interior glass surfaces.Effective methods for preventing interior fogging on windows during winter drives include:

  • Utilize the Air Conditioning System: Even in cold weather, running your air conditioning system can dehumidify the air inside your car, reducing condensation. Set the climate control to draw in fresh outside air rather than recirculating interior air.
  • Proper Ventilation: Slightly cracking a window can help equalize the temperature and humidity levels inside and outside the vehicle, preventing fog buildup.
  • Clean Interior Glass: Ensure the inside of your windows is clean. A thin film of dust or grime can provide nucleation sites for water droplets, exacerbating fogging. Use an automotive glass cleaner and a microfiber cloth.
  • Anti-Fog Treatments: Apply an anti-fog treatment specifically designed for automotive interiors. These treatments create a barrier that prevents water droplets from forming a fog. Follow product instructions carefully for application.
  • Avoid Bringing Excess Moisture In: Shake off snow and water from your shoes and clothing before entering the car to minimize the amount of moisture introduced into the cabin.

Preventative Measures for Frozen Components

Preventing common winter detailing frustrations like frozen door locks, seals, and windows requires foresight and the use of specific products and techniques. These measures ensure that your vehicle remains accessible and protected from the harsh effects of freezing temperatures.

  • Door Locks: Before winter sets in, apply a graphite-based lubricant or a silicone spray to door lock cylinders. This helps to displace moisture and prevent freezing. If a lock does freeze, avoid forcing it; instead, try a lock de-icer or gently warm the key with a lighter (being careful not to overheat).
  • Door Seals and Weatherstripping: Apply a silicone-based protectant or a rubber conditioner to all door seals and weatherstripping. This creates a barrier that repels water and prevents seals from freezing to the car body. Regularly cleaning and conditioning these areas is crucial.
  • Windows and Sunroofs: Ensure all windows and sunroofs are fully closed and sealed. If there’s a risk of freezing shut, a light application of silicone spray along the edges can help. For stubborn frost, use a dedicated automotive de-icer spray rather than scraping, which can scratch the glass.

Impact of Extreme Cold on Detailing Chemicals and Equipment

The performance and longevity of your detailing supplies can be significantly compromised by frigid temperatures. Understanding these effects allows for proper storage and handling to maintain their efficacy and prevent damage.

  • Chemical Freezing: Many water-based detailing products, such as shampoos, all-purpose cleaners, and waxes, have a freezing point. Storing these indoors in a temperature-controlled environment is paramount. If a product has frozen, allow it to thaw completely at room temperature before use; shaking it vigorously may be necessary to reintegrate separated components.
  • Equipment Degradation: Rubber hoses can become stiff and prone to cracking in the cold. It’s advisable to drain them thoroughly after use and store them indoors. Pressure washers and their pumps can also suffer damage from freezing water; ensure they are properly winterized if stored outdoors.
  • Reduced Applicator Performance: Microfiber towels can become stiff and less absorbent when frozen. Allow them to thaw and dry completely before use. Foam applicators and brushes may also become less pliable.

It is crucial to remember that certain products, like those containing alcohol or specialized de-icers, are designed for cold weather use and can be beneficial. Always check the product’s label for recommended temperature ranges.

Preventing Water Freezing in Pressure Washers and Equipment

Water freezing within your pressure washer or other water-dependent equipment can cause significant damage, including cracked pumps, hoses, and other components. Taking preventative measures is essential to protect your investment and ensure operational readiness.To safeguard your equipment from the damaging effects of freezing temperatures:

  • After each use, disconnect all hoses and accessories from the pressure washer.
  • Drain as much water as possible from the pump and hoses. Tilting the unit can help facilitate complete drainage.
  • Run the pressure washer for a few seconds without the water supply connected. This helps to expel any residual water from the pump.
  • Consider using a RV/Marine antifreeze specifically designed for pressure washers. Follow the manufacturer’s instructions for introducing the antifreeze into the system.
  • Store your pressure washer in a location that remains above freezing temperatures. If this is not possible, ensure it is thoroughly winterized with antifreeze.
  • For other water-holding equipment, such as garden hoses or buckets, ensure they are completely emptied and stored indoors or in a protected area.
